Which statement describes the offspring of the F1 generation when crossing a pea plant that is true breeding for green seeds with a pea plant that is true breeding for yellow seeds?
Answer:
The question lacks options, the options are:
A. The green trait is the dominant trait.
B. The offspring will inherit one gene from each parent.
C. The offspring will have both green and yellow seeds.
D. Each offspring will have a unique set of alleles.
The answer is optionB
Explanation:
This question describes a monohybrid cross i.e. involving a single gene coding for seed colour in pea plant. One allele codes for green seeds and the other for yellow seeds.
Based on the question, a plant that has the same alleles for yellow seeds is crossed with another plant that has same alleles for green seeds. The offsprings produced will have two different alleles i.e. heterozygous, contributed by each parent.
Hence, the offsprings will inherit one form of the gene from each parent.

Explain the relationship between electricity and magnetism
Explanation: Ok so, Electricity and magnetism are two related phenomena produced by the electromagnetic force. And together, they form electromagnetism. A moving electric charge generates a magnetic field. A magnetic field induces electric charge movement, producing an electric current. ( Relationship of them ) Electric current produces a magnetic field. Electric currents and magnets exert force on each other, and this relationship has many uses. A temporary magnet, known as an electromagnet, can be made by passing electric current through a wire that is coiled around an iron core..

Was it beneficial or harmful for the Chthamalus barnacle to add the Balanus barnacle? Explain.
Answer:
It was it harmful for the Chthamalus barnacle to add the Balanus barnacle.
Explanation:
The principle of competitive exclusion says that two different species that share the same niche can not live in the same place. If these species have the same requirements, they can not coexist. Two species can not coexist indefinitely on the bases of the same limited resource.
When two competing species coexist, this is because of niche partitioning or niche differentiation. If there is not any differentiation between them, the dominant species displaces the weak species.
In the exposed example, Chthalamus can live in the upper intertidal zone, where Balanus can not live because they can not tolerate desiccation. Balanus live in the lower intertidal zone, where Chthalamus can not live because of its vulnerability to predation. But these two species compete for the middle intertidal zone, where they can both live. Balanus excludes Chthalamus because the first species is much bigger and grows faster than the second one. So the middle intertidal zone is only inhabited by Balanus.
The area occupied by Chthalamus is smaller in the presence of Balanus. In the absence of Balanus, Chthalamus can live in a bigger area, occupying the middle intertidal zone.

A forest fire destroys an area. A small population of trees and a large population of birds are both affected. Which type of
limiting factor causes this?
Odensity dependent
Odensity independent
O population dependent
population independent
Answer:
density independent
Explanation:
In Ecology, a limiting factor refers to an environmental condition that hinders the growth and distribution of organisms in an ECOSYSTEM. A limiting factor hinders or hampers the productivity of an organism in its habitat.
There are two major types of limiting factors that affect organisms in their ecosystem viz: density dependent and density independent limiting factors. Density independent factor limits the size of a population independently of how dense the ecosystem's population is. This means that density independent factor affects a population irrespective of its size. Example of density independent factor are natural disasters e.g earthquake, hurricane, forest fire as mentioned in the question.
In this question, both populations of trees and birds are affected irrespective of the size of the ecosystem's population.
